Chandler Hughes, a six-year-old from Humble, Texas, is regarded as one of the smartest kids in the state—if not the entire nation. Intending to become a doctor in the future, Hughes has joined the prestigious Mensa Society.

The young prodigy told KPRC, “A medical doctor because I want to help people when they are sick.”




His father disclosed, “It started early, started reading at one year, nine months.”

He added that although his son is in a wonderful setting where both his instructors and peers support him, he still wants to work on his sociability because Hughes is an intellectual.
